Role Overview

This role is accountable for assisting with the end-to-end accounting and compliance processes associated with the CUK Accounting Team and ensuring that prime entries are accurately accounted for and controlled. Specifically, this role is focussed on the General & Administrative costs which broadly correlates to central overheads. This role will also provide ad-hoc technical accounting advice and project support as required and support initiatives to streamline or automate processes to drive out inefficiencies and improve processes and performance.

This pivotal role will involve:

  • Accountable for assigned month end accounting processes, including journal and balance sheet reconciliation preparation and scrutiny
  • Ensures accurate financial information is prepared to the required deadlines and with due care and attention
  • Ensure areas of accounting judgement are clearly managed, flagged in advance of any movement and simply communicate
  • Assists with preparation of deliverables for Corporate, internal & external auditors and any other relevant bodies

This role is positioned at CUK10 level within our organisation and is available on a full-time permanent basis. We offer hybrid work including up to two days from home.

How to prepare for a job interview at Carnival Corporation & plc

✨Know Your Numbers

As an Assistant Management Accountant, you'll be dealing with financial data daily. Brush up on your accounting principles and be ready to discuss how you've applied them in past roles. Familiarise yourself with key metrics relevant to Carnival UK's operations, especially around General & Administrative costs.

✨Excel Skills are Key

Since advanced Excel skills are a must for this role, make sure you can demonstrate your proficiency. Prepare to discuss specific functions or tools you've used in Excel that have helped streamline processes or improve accuracy in your previous work.

✨Communicate Clearly

Effective communication is crucial in finance. Practice explaining complex financial concepts in simple terms. Be prepared to showcase your verbal and written communication skills, perhaps by discussing a time when you had to present financial information to non-financial stakeholders.

✨Show Your Resilience

Working under pressure is part of the job, so think of examples where you've successfully met tight deadlines. Share how you manage stress and maintain accuracy during busy periods, as this will show your potential employer that you're ready for the challenges of the role.
